    Reggie Greenwood reacted to Crewton in Beer in Derby   
    Smithfield for Bass, IME 
    Add the Greyhound, Babbingtons, Standing Order, Mr Grundy's, Furnace and Five Lamps. 
    Haven't been in the Last Post, Little Chester Ale House or the Old Bell recently, but they were all decent last time I went in. 
    The Dolphin was always a good place for Bass and real ale generally, but I've had reports of variable quality recently though I haven't been in myself since about September. 
  15. Cheers
    Reggie Greenwood reacted to Mr. P in Beer in Derby   
    Burton lol
    Coopers Tavern. Straight from the barrel in the bar, rather through pipes & a pump. It comes out with no head on or having to wait for it to settle.
